Kā instalēt PostgreSQL Ubuntu

postgreSQL

PostgreSQL ir a datu bāzes pārvaldības sistēma bez maksas ar licenci ar tādu pašu nosaukumu, kurai ir arī atbalsts saglabātajām procedūrām tādās valodās kā Java, C ++, Ruby, Python Perl ...

Izlemšana, vai izmantot MySQL vai PostgreSQL, var būt dilemma. Šķiet, ka pirmais ir nedaudz ātrāks par otro, bet otrais, būdams bez maksas, ir daudz blīvāks funkciju ziņā. Tāpēc iekšā Ubunlog mēs vēlamies jums iemācīt, kā download, instalēt y sagatavot PostgreSQL lietošanai Ubuntu (vai jebkuru citu Linux izplatītāju) pēc iespējas vienkāršākā veidā.

PostgreSQL instalēšana

Lai to instalētu, mums tas ir jādara pievienot jaunu krātuvi mūsu krātuvju sarakstam. Mēs to varam viegli izdarīt, pievienojot mūsu rindiņu sources.list ar attiecīgo repozitoriju. Šim nolūkam mēs izpildām:

sudo sh -c 'echo «deb http: // apt.postgresql.org / pub / repos / apt /` lsb_release -cs`-pgdg main »>> /etc/apt/sources.list.d/pgdg.list'

Tagad mums tas ir jādara lejupielādēt GPG atslēgu lai apt varētu pārbaudīt to pakotņu derīgumu, kuras mēs lejupielādējam no iepriekšējā krātuves. Mēs izpildām:

wget -q https://www.postgresql.org/media/keys/ACCC4CF8.asc -O - | sudo apt-key pievienot -

Nākamais mēs atjaunojam krātuves:

sudo apt-get update

Un visbeidzot, mēs instalējam paketes atbilstošā PostgreSQL:

 sudo apt-get install postgresql postgresql-contrib

Sagatavojiet PostgreSQL lietošanai

Lai sāktu izmantot PostgreSQL, mums vispirms tas ir jādara savienojiet mūs ar savu serveri. Lai to izdarītu, instalējot PostgreSQL, mums faktiski ir izveidoja sistēmas lietotāju ar nosaukumu "postgres". Šim lietotājam ir PostgreSQL datu bāzes administrēšanas privilēģijas, tāpēc pirmais solis ir piesakieties ar šo lietotāju:

sudo su - postgres

Tagad mums tas ir jādara sāciet PostgreSQL termināli lai pieteiktos datu bāzes serverī. Lai to izdarītu, mēs izpildām 'psql' un mēs mēs reģistrējamies lai izveidotu savienojumu ar serveri.

psql

Ja mēs vēlamies apskatīt saistība vai versija kas mums ir no PostgreSQL, mēs varam izpildīt šādu komandu:

postgres- # \ conninfo

Visbeidzot, par atvienojiet no servera no datu bāzes, mēs to varam izdarīt, izpildot sekojošo:

postgres- # \ q

izeja

Ievērojiet, ka tiek izpildīta komanda «exit» izejas sesija ka mēs sākumā bijām sākuši zem lietotāja «postgres».

Ja PostgreSQL instalēšanas vai sagatavošanas laikā jums ir bijušas kādas problēmas, lūdzu, atstājiet mūs komentāru sadaļā, un mēs darīsim visu iespējamo, lai jums palīdzētu. Līdz nākamajai reizei.


Atstājiet savu komentāru

Jūsu e-pasta adrese netiks publicēta. Obligātie lauki ir atzīmēti ar *

*

*

  1. Atbildīgais par datiem: Migels Ángels Gatóns
  2. Datu mērķis: SPAM kontrole, komentāru pārvaldība.
  3. Legitimācija: jūsu piekrišana
  4. Datu paziņošana: Dati netiks paziņoti trešām personām, izņemot juridiskus pienākumus.
  5. Datu glabāšana: datu bāze, ko mitina Occentus Networks (ES)
  6. Tiesības: jebkurā laikā varat ierobežot, atjaunot un dzēst savu informāciju.

  1.   Pedrins Bermeo (@pedropaulbermeo) teica

    Ar pirmo komandrindu es saņemu sekojošo
    "Deb: 1:" deb: 'echo: nav atrasts

  2.   Erik teica

    izcils bro